OneKey OneKey is an open-source hardware wallet supporting Solana and 30,000+ tokens across 100+ blockchains. Salmon Salmon is an open-source, community-owned Solana wallet delivered as a browser extension, built with an emphasis on transparency and security. OneKey offers 5 features including Support for Solana and 30,000+ tokens across 100+ blockchains, Secure element chips for offline private key storage, SignGuard phishing protection blocking malicious transactions, and 2 more. Salmon counters with 5 features including Open-source, community-owned Solana wallet browser extension, Transaction simulation to preview outcomes before signing, Full SPL token support, and 2 more. OneKey's key strengths include fully open-source and independently auditable, signguard has blocked over 1 million scam attempts, secure element chips protect keys offline. Salmon stands out for open, auditable code lets users verify how keys are handled, transaction simulation helps catch malicious actions before signing, community-owned framing aligns incentives with users.
